A DRUG dealer, who was caught with more than 16 grams of class A drugs in Andover, has been jailed for over two years.

19-year-old Johnny Harvey, from Mount Pleasant Road, Tottenham, was sentenced to 30 months imprisonment for two counts of possession of controlled class A drugs with intent to supply.

Harvey, who was appearing at Winchester Crown Court last Wednesday, was caught with 10 grams of crack cocaine and 6.6 grams of diamorphine in Verity Square, Andover on June 1.

He was arrested and remained in custody before his trial after breaking a previously suspended prison sentence.

For each count Harvey was given a 30 month prison sentence, both of which will run concurrently.
